Researchers said it could explain why people with a higher IQ were healthier as a vegetarian diet was linked to lower heart disease and obesity(肥胖) rates. The study of 8,179 was reported in the British Medical Journal.Twenty years after the IQ tests were carried out in 1970, 366 of the participants said they were vegetarianalthough more than 100 reported eating either fish or chicken.Men who were vegetarian had an IQ score of 106, pared with 101 for nonvegetarians; while female vegetarians averaged 104, pared with 99 for nonvegetarians. There was no difference in the IQ score between strict vegetarians and those who said they were vegetarian but reported eating fish or chicken.Researchers said the findings were partly related to better education and higher class, but it remained statistically(统计地) significant after adjusting for these factors.Vegetarians were more likely to be female, to be of higher social class and to have higher academic or professional qualifications than nonvegetarians. However, these differences were not reflected in their annual ine, which was similar to that of nonvegetarians. Lead researcher Catharine Gale said,“The findings that children with greater intelligence are more likely to report being vegetarians than adults, together with the evidence on the potential benefits of a vegetarian diet on heart health, may help to explain why a higher IQ in childhood or adolescence is linked with a reduced risk of coronary heart disease (冠心病)in adult life.”But Dr Frankie Phillips, of the British Dietetic Association, said:“It_is_like_the_chicken_and_the_egg.
